WGSF Senior Schools are delighted to be presenting a musical theatre production of 'The Sound of Music'.

Having recently celebrated its 50th anniversary this widely popular musical is often voted one of the Nation's favourites.

Based on the tale of the real-life Von Trapp family, the show tells the story of neglected children brought together by the love and enthusiasm of their new governess, Maria, who, despite her vow to become a nun, finds herself romantically entangled with their stern and disciplinarian father, Captain Von Trapp. Set against the background of the dark days of Austria in the 1930s, the family must come together to overcome the advancing Nazi threat.

Featuring sing-a-long numbers such as Do-Re-Mi, My Favourite Things and Eidelweiss, this is a musical for the whole family to enjoy. Featuring a cast of performers from both WGHS and QEGS, as well as talented musicians from our School Orchestra, this promises to be an entertaining night out!
